Description Factor VIIa (FVIIa) is a key serine protease involved in the initiation of thecoagulation cascade. FVIIa requires tissue factor (TF), a membrane boundprotein, as an essential cofactor for maximal activity towards its biologicalsubstrates Factor X, Factor IX and Factor VII (FVII).
